ZUTATEN
Seafood
- 🦑 1 squid
Vegetables
- 🧅 1/2 onion
- 🥒 1/3 zucchini
- 🧄 Some green onion
Seasonings
- 🧂 1 tbsp soy sauce
- 🧂 1 tbsp Korean soy sauce
- 1 tbsp plum extract
- 🧄 1 tbsp minced garlic
- 1 tbsp oligosaccharide
- 🍬 1/2 tbsp sugar
- 1/2 tbsp sesame oil
- Some sesame seeds
- 🧂 Some salt
- Some pepper
- 1/2 tbsp cooking wine
SCHRITTE
Clean the squid thoroughly under running water and prepare it.
Cut the squid into bite-sized pieces.
Marinate the squid with salt, pepper, and cooking wine.
Slice the onion and zucchini into thin strips.
Cut the green onion diagonally into thin slices.
Stir-fry minced garlic, onion, and zucchini in a pan.
Add the marinated squid to the pan and stir-fry lightly.
Pour the pre-mixed sauce into the pan and stir-fry again.
Add green onion, sesame oil, and sesame seeds before serving.

💡 Tipps
Avoid overcooking the squid to maintain its tender texture.You can substitute zucchini with other vegetables like bell peppers.Serve with steamed rice for a complete meal.
